Tornado Cash plaintiffs seek appeals after federal court losses

Despite recent losses in court, interested parties and crypto industry players are not giving up their fight against Tornado Cash sanctions. 

Plaintiffs in two cases are bringing their battle against the US Treasury Department to federal appellate courts. Joseph Van Loon, along with five other self-identified “Ethereum blockchain users” sued the US Treasury Department, Secretary Janet Yellen, the Office of Foreign Asset Control (OFAC) and OFAC Director Andrea Gacki in September 2022.

Goldman, BNP Paribas lead Fnality’s $95M round

Blockchain payments startup Fnalityhas raised a new $95 million funding round.

Goldman Sachs and BNP Paribas led the round. Euroclear, DTCC, WisdomTree and Nomura also participated.

The company is known for creating tokenized versions of major currencies, which are collateralized by cash held at central banks. So far, it has tokenized fiat currencies including US dollars, euros, British pounds, Canadian dollars, and Japanese yen.

LATEST: Cryptocurrency Market to Reach $25 Trillion by 2030, Predicts ARK Invest CEO

ARK Invest CEO Cathie Wood predicts that the cryptocurrency market will soar to a staggering $25 trillion by 2030. In an interview with CNBC, Wood expressed her optimism about the future of crypto as ARK Invest prepares to launch five new ETFs in collaboration with 21 Shares. She also acknowledged the role of anticipation in the market, suggesting that some price increases may be due to speculation on ETF approvals. Despite this, Wood emphasized the importance of underlying fundamentals, highlighting Bitcoin’s resilience and potential during times of economic uncertainty. The current crypto market cap is $1.43 trillion.

Centralized exchange OKX launches decentralized L2 with Polygon CDK

Popular centralized exchange OKX is launching its very own zkEVM (zero-knowledge Ethereum Virtual Machine) layer-2 network testnet using Polygon’s chain development kit (CDK) today.

The network, named X1, will mark the centralized exchange’s first steps into building and developing its own on-chain environment.

According to information available on DeFiLlama, OKX is one of the largest centralized exchanges today, with total assets of over $12 billion.

Bim Afolami takes the reins on UK crypto policy as new Economic Secretary

King Charles II has approved the appointment of Member of Parliament Bim Afolami to the position of Economic Secretary to the Treasury of the United Kingdom.

In a Nov. 13 notice, the U.K. government said Afolami was one of several appointments in restructuring ministers and secretaries. As Economic Secretary, he will control many policies affecting the adoption of digital assets and central bank digital currencies in the United Kingdom.

Disney launches NFT platform with Dapper Labs

Disney has created a nonfungible tokens (NFT) platform together with blockchain and metaverse firm Dapper Labs.

According to the November 14 announcement, Disney will tokenize its iconic cartoon characters from the past century onto its NFT marketplace dubbed “Disney Pinnacle.” The platform will also include icons from Pixar as well as heroes and villains from the Star Wars galaxy, uniquely styled as collectible and tradable digital pins. “Fans anywhere will be able to collect dynamic pins on their phone and trade instantly and securely with each other no matter where they are in the world,” Dapper Labs’ CEO Roham Gharegozlou explained.

Hong Kong Based Boyaa Plans to Buy $45 million Worth of Bitcoin As Treasury Reserve Asset

Boyaa Interactive, a Hong Kong-based gaming company, revealed plans for a potential investment in c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in, as this endeavor seeks to enhance the Group’s asset allocation strategy.

Following an earlier voluntary announcement in August 2023, Boyaa’s Board views BTC and crypto acquisition as pivotal for its business expansion and asset allocation strategy. The company aims to seek shareholders’ approval to authorize a $100 million acquisition mandate for purchasing Bitcoin, crypto, and stablecoins within a 12-month period.

Bitcoin bounces at $36.2K lows as CPI inflation slows beyond forecasts

Bitcoin (BTC) targeted $37,000 at the Nov. 14 Wall Street open as the latest United States inflation data undercut expectations.

BTC/USD 1-hour chart. Source: TradingViewCPI offers Bitcoin, stocks a pleasant surprise

Data from Cointelegraph Markets Pro and TradingView showed BTC price strength returning as the Consumer Price Index (CPI) reflected slowing inflation in October.

CPI came in 0.1% below market forecasts both year-on-year and month-on-month. The annual change was 3.2%, versus 4.0% for core CPI.
